When checking a client’s medication profile, a nurse notes that the client is receiving a drug contraindicated for clients with glaucoma. The nurse knows that this client, who has a history of glaucoma, has been taking the medication for the past 3 days. What should the nurse do first? O Hold the medication and report the information to the health care provider to ensure client safety. Find out whether there are extenuating reasons for giving the drug to this client. File an incident report because several other staff members have given the medication to the client. Continue to give the medication because the client has been taking it for 3 days.
